Markus Staab
|
766ceccd00
|
Print number of classes contained within the generated classmap
to give the developer a better feeling about number of dependent classes
|
2018-08-27 14:51:04 +02:00 |
Jordi Boggiano
|
a74b63985e
|
Avoid filtering dev-require packages when loading plugins/scripts, fixes #7516
|
2018-08-04 17:43:43 +02:00 |
Jordi Boggiano
|
ff59bbdab0
|
CS fixer
|
2018-07-24 14:32:52 +02:00 |
Gabriel Caruso
|
7d9f8e2247
|
Improvements
Small improvements, such as remove unused imports, unecessaries casts, parentheses, etc.
|
2018-07-05 07:44:43 -03:00 |
Jordi Boggiano
|
eedbd218f5
|
Make sure circular dependencies do not break the autoload dumper, refs #7316, refs #7348
|
2018-05-31 17:02:04 +02:00 |
Philipp Fritsche
|
b0be87177d
|
Filter dev-dependencies from "dump-autoload --no-dev" , fixes #4343
|
2018-05-08 02:57:26 +02:00 |
Nicolas Grekas
|
0c912d6eee
|
Fix generated static map...
|
2018-01-04 17:31:44 +01:00 |
Nicolas Grekas
|
ce70e0e9dd
|
Fix BC of generated static map
|
2018-01-04 14:11:50 +01:00 |
Jordi Boggiano
|
3be9591930
|
Simplify some ClassLoader code, minor memory improvement, fixes #6937
|
2018-01-03 16:24:22 +01:00 |
Vladimir Reznichenko
|
c8615358cb
|
SCA with PHP Inspections (EA Extended)
|
2017-09-11 19:40:43 +02:00 |
Jordi Boggiano
|
17b7387c37
|
Merge branch '1.4'
|
2017-07-06 09:56:17 +02:00 |
Jordi Boggiano
|
47bc2fa51a
|
Fix exclude-from-classmap being ignored when generating on-the-fly class loader, fixes #6503
|
2017-07-06 09:51:25 +02:00 |
Saumini Navaratnam
|
27b8209990
|
Fix for issue #6492
Able to include specific finle in phar in "files" option in composer
|
2017-06-19 17:04:16 +02:00 |
Li Chuangbo
|
1f4882a3e6
|
Revert "Fixed an issue when a phar file is used in "files" option in composer.json"
This reverts commit 41e91f3064 .
The commit 41e91f3 in current codebase generates absolute path in
autoload_static.php for phar file.
Also according to http://php.net/manual/en/phar.using.intro.php, the `phar://`
prefix is not needed.
|
2017-06-15 14:38:04 +02:00 |
Jordi Boggiano
|
122e422682
|
CS fixes
|
2017-03-08 15:16:44 +01:00 |
Jordi Boggiano
|
1dcb2b5758
|
Merge remote-tracking branch 'nicolas-grekas/apcu'
|
2016-12-07 00:21:13 +01:00 |
Jordi Boggiano
|
e9d04f2b2d
|
Merge branch '1.2'
|
2016-12-06 17:04:39 +01:00 |
Hans-Joachim Michl
|
817b2747c7
|
Fix #5672
This fixes the issue reported in #5672.
It just makes sure the ZendGuard encoded files can be autoloaded correctly.
|
2016-12-06 17:02:27 +01:00 |
Nicolas Grekas
|
6d4e60b991
|
Add --apcu-autoloader option to enable APCu caching of found/not-found classes
|
2016-12-06 11:21:44 +01:00 |
Konstantin.Myakshin
|
dc70b40d34
|
Use implode instead of join
|
2016-10-11 16:52:29 +03:00 |
Kévin Dunglas
|
3e3fd3c6b1
|
Remove unused variable
|
2016-10-09 22:40:30 +02:00 |
Jordi Boggiano
|
902a5c32db
|
Add bug ref
|
2016-09-29 08:06:44 +02:00 |
AnrDaemon
|
c774d41a9c
|
Fix realpath() failing on Windows
|
2016-09-29 08:05:55 +02:00 |
SpacePossum
|
2ae0800cd3
|
Remove useless concat.
|
2016-09-16 14:50:34 +02:00 |
Nicolas Grekas
|
c6b26c4e96
|
Make static inlining more selective
|
2016-08-30 15:25:17 +02:00 |
Jordi Boggiano
|
c289776d94
|
Force-collapse multiple slashes into one, fixes #5387
|
2016-05-31 19:37:39 +01:00 |
Jordi Boggiano
|
d1a0502f92
|
Make sure we only replace complete paths to the base-dir/vendor-dir, not partial dir matches, fixes #5289
|
2016-05-05 14:57:07 +01:00 |
Jordi Boggiano
|
4f6693ad70
|
Fix regression in 0b44662087 , fixes #5199
|
2016-04-15 15:37:00 +01:00 |
Jordi Boggiano
|
0b44662087
|
Disable static autoloader on HHVM, fixes #5192
|
2016-04-15 14:57:07 +01:00 |
Nicolas Grekas
|
40aca80bd9
|
Workaround https://bugs.php.net/68057
|
2016-04-12 09:32:54 +02:00 |
Nicolas Grekas
|
fd2f51cea8
|
Speedup autoloading on PHP 5.6 & 7.0+ using static arrays
|
2016-04-11 19:38:24 +02:00 |
Jordi Boggiano
|
cdea645eab
|
Avoid outputing duplicate warnings for ambiguous class resolution, fixes #4953
|
2016-02-24 13:07:17 +00:00 |
Jordi Boggiano
|
bda2c0f9b7
|
Re-enable include path even when classmap authoritative is present, refs #4556
|
2016-01-09 19:12:26 +00:00 |
Jordi Boggiano
|
e05207dbad
|
Merge remote-tracking branch 'bp1222/save-loads'
|
2016-01-09 19:10:39 +00:00 |
Jordi Boggiano
|
8072448cf3
|
Adjust deduplication of files autoloads, refs 9710b26d3f
|
2015-11-26 10:39:16 +00:00 |
Jordi Boggiano
|
966a982738
|
CS fixes
|
2015-11-21 19:28:10 +00:00 |
Jordi Boggiano
|
1fe690f810
|
Autoload generator cleanups
|
2015-11-21 18:33:17 +00:00 |
Jordi Boggiano
|
3748c11709
|
Simplify files autoload include function, and make sure files are included once per package even if exactly the same, refs #4186
|
2015-11-21 18:30:44 +00:00 |
Jordi Boggiano
|
9710b26d3f
|
Merge remote-tracking branch 'jeskew/feature/require_files_but_once'
|
2015-11-21 17:31:05 +00:00 |
Jordi Boggiano
|
c0b49d09f3
|
Merge remote-tracking branch 'cw-ozaki/no-script-dump-autoload'
Conflicts:
src/Composer/Autoload/AutoloadGenerator.php
src/Composer/Command/DumpAutoloadCommand.php
|
2015-11-21 17:14:33 +00:00 |
Jordi Boggiano
|
6f29df01d2
|
Fix updir regex matching, refs #4607
|
2015-11-14 15:44:30 +00:00 |
Omer Karadagli
|
4046ae042d
|
Up-level relative paths in exclude-from-classmap
|
2015-11-12 15:53:47 +00:00 |
Rob Bast
|
991d25115f
|
fixes #4562
|
2015-11-05 18:47:30 +01:00 |
annesosensio
|
2e4157145b
|
Made wildcard expansion consistent with bash
|
2015-10-30 21:30:50 +01:00 |
Jordi Boggiano
|
6c16510743
|
Add support for wildcards in exclude-from-classmap, refs #1607
|
2015-10-30 19:12:30 +00:00 |
Jordi Boggiano
|
f1b0c073ad
|
Tweaked exclude-from-classmap: windows support, normalize paths and make sure they are all package-relative and do not leak to other packages, refs #1607
|
2015-10-30 00:22:04 +00:00 |
Jordi Boggiano
|
084f6de24e
|
Merge remote-tracking branch 'trivago/add_exclude'
Conflicts:
doc/04-schema.md
src/Composer/Autoload/AutoloadGenerator.php
|
2015-10-30 00:00:44 +00:00 |
David Walker
|
e0a6419992
|
When classmap authoratative is enabled, there should be no reason to load 3 files, and process them when autoloader will return false
|
2015-10-28 14:29:36 -06:00 |
Jordi Boggiano
|
6582c337d0
|
Fix typo
|
2015-10-28 00:06:21 +00:00 |
Jordi Boggiano
|
1160b782c8
|
Deduplicate classmap creation and add support for loading classmaps on the fly for plugins & co
|
2015-10-27 17:47:25 +00:00 |